The main issue related to this course is the lack of placements. Mainly the placements are available for only statistics and economics students while the mathematics students rarely get any placement. The only career options available are teaching, become mathematicians and government employees. The course is comparatively easy and you can score good cgpa in it. The only difficult subject is Analysis but you can understand it.

Internships Opportunities

3

There is a internship society available in the college known as Abhyas - the internship cell. It provides various internship opportunities to all the students and prepare themselves for the future. The stipend is around Rs 5,000-10,000. The internships are mostly available around the Noida side.

Placement Experience

3

There is very rare placement for my course in my college. If you want any placement, you have to do minor in some other subjects like economics and statistics. You can masters after that and then PhD. Then you can become a great mathematician in future too. Most students are thinking to clear the Upsc and other government exams after the graduation. If you want to any placement you have to score around 9.5 cgpa in your 6 semesters.

Fees and Financial Aid

The fees of my course in the Hindu College is Rs. 27970 for the general/obc category and Rs. 27785 for the Sc/St category. There is no other charges other than that except the examination fees which is around Rs. 2000. There are many scholarships available for the students like the nsp scholarship of amount Rs. 12000 for Sc/St students. Other scholarship is inspire which is available for the students who scored more than 95 percent marks in the 12th class.

Campus Life

5

There is basically a fest during the Diwali called 'Suruchi' in the college in which various stalls are available for the students who want to buy things for Diwali. Then the annual fest Mecca occurs in the month of April in the college in which various celebrities come to entertain the students of college. There are many books available for the English and Hindi hons. students so that they can find books related to their course. Journals are also available for all the students. All classrooms have projectors which supports virtual classes. There is a volleyball and basketball court in the college and the sports ground of the college is the biggest in the north campus. There are various societies in the college like nss, ncc which are helpful for the students in the future life.

Admission

I choose this college as it got the NIRF rank 1 in 2024. The college is very diverse in terms of courses and students. The college has a campus area of around 25 acre. I have applied for the other colleges of north campus too but Hindu College was my first priority. I got it in the first round of common seat allocation system so I didn't need to bother to choose other colleges. I have to give cuet exam so that I can take admission in Delhi University. The eligibility for my course was to study mathematics till 12th class and the student who has given maths exam in cuet and 2 other subject and 1 language exam. Then the cutoff for this course comes in various colleges. College and course are allotted on the CSAS portal of Delhi University. Then the students have to accept that seat and pay the fees.

Faculty

4

There are total 61 students in my class and 11 faculty members in my department. Around 200 students are there in my course. The faculty members are very understanding and help us in every possible way. Actually I like the whole faculty but Bindu Bansal mam of Analysis is my favourite. Her teaching skills are so nice which makes it easier for students to understand the concepts. There are 2 semesters in each year and students have to give exams at the end of each semester. Exams are easy to pass, the only difficult one was the Elementary Real Analysis. You have to score 40 percent marks to pass in theory exams. Just 7-8 students fail to pass the exam each semester. Some faculty members are strict but there is no lack of efforts by them. We can easily approach to them without any hesitation as some are very very friendly and kind.

Placement Experience:

Placements in IGNOU are quite limited compared to regular universities. Since IGNOU is an open and distance learning university, it does not have a strong campus placement system like DU or private colleges. There is a Campus Placement Cell (CPC) that conducts job fairs and recruitment drives at some regional centers, but these are not very frequent and mostly depend on the location. Usually, students who are in their final year or have completed the course can apply, but there is no fixed semester rule since the system is flexible. The companies that visit are not very large in number and vary every year. Some private firms, NGOs, BPOs, insurance companies, and small IT firms have participated in the past. The roles are generally entry-level such as sales, customer support, data entry, insurance advisor, or junior IT support. There are very limited opportunities for core mathematics or research roles through placements. As far as packages are concerned, the average package is usually around ?2.5 LPA to ?4 LPA, but since IGNOU is an open university, it cannot be expected to have the same placement levels as regular colleges with full-time classes. Also, the percentage of students placed is very small because most IGNOU students are either working professionals, homemakers, or people preparing for competitive exams, so placements are not the main focus. Many students use the degree as a qualification while pursuing their own career path outside. I am currently in my 2nd year, so I do not have personal placement experience yet. The data I have mentioned here is based on internet sources and feedback from other IGNOU students. From what I have learned, placements exist but are very limited, and one should not rely only on them for career building.
